Handover note — Crumbwheel order cutoffs.

Welcome aboard. The bakery cutoff rule in Crumbwheel closes same-day orders at 14:00 local to each storefront, not UTC — this has bitten us twice. Holiday overrides live in the calendar service and take precedence silently, so always check there first when a cutoff looks wrong. To unlock the calendar service's admin console after a restart, enter the recovery passphrase below.

vault phrase of bagap-bahaf = silion-pelox-sorox-casdor-quenwyn-fraax-eliox-praael-kelion-quenvan-kasox-rusael-norius-belvan

MEMO — Kettling Depot Receiving

Uniform sets for the new Kettling depot arrive Wednesday via Ashgrove courier: 40 boxes, sorted by size, manifest attached to box one. Check the count at the dock before signing; shortages go straight to stores, not the courier. The hand-over instruction the courier will follow is set out below.

drop instructions, tafof-baguf: the holmir gilox courier leaves the sormir ulaok holdor ledger at gate 5596 under passcode 257343

Internal Memo — Budget Request

Welcome aboard! Before you settle in, a heads-up: the Farrowgate team has asked for additional budget to extend the Silvane pilot through spring. Numbers look reasonable, and ops supports it. You'll want to sign off before month-end. There's one confidential point you should see first, noted below.

confidential, kajof-tahof: The pricing group signed off on a budget of $491.8 million for Project Casvan.

// The Lunaria payments integration suite has been flaky since the
// Tollbridge sandbox started throttling concurrent auth calls. We cap
// parallel test workers at this value until the upstream fix lands.
// Do not raise it without checking the sandbox rate dashboard first.
// The last stable run that validated this cap is recorded below.

trace token, fafog-kageg: htk4_98e6